Taishi Hirokawa
Timescapes



Time flies. It is constantly rushing towards, over, and past us as we negotiate our lives. But photographer Taishi Hirokawa has found a way to stop time, or rather capture a large chuck of time and present it in an unusual and unique form through his amazing time-lapse photographs. Using a large format camera custom made to his specifications, he has managed to compress the eternal passage of time into a single image, giving us a peek into the unimaginable immensity of the universe.


Hirokawa makes two exposures on each film, one a daylight image of a rock-strewn landscape, the other a time exposure of the midnight stars swirling overhead. The result is a surreal image that combines two immense themes. Our home planet was created eons ago from a boiling cauldron of primal elements, and the ageless rocks that Hirokawa photographs remind us of this ancient heritage. Then, long after these daylight exposures are made, with the earth shrouded in darkness, he opens his lens all night to capture the star tracks circling overhead. The light from these distant stars must travel thousands of years to reach his camera, and their motion reveals our insignificant place on this backwater spiral towards the outer fringes of our galaxy. White Room Gallery proudly presents "Timescapes", the latest work from this ingenious Tokyo-based photographer. Mr. Hirokawa's work has been avidly sought by such notable museums as the San Francisco Museum of Modern Art, Los Angeles country Museum of Art, and Tokyo Metropolitan Museum of Photography. His books include "Timescapes", "Sonomama, Sonomama", and "Still Crazy", a look at nuclear power plants in the Japanese landscape.
